Long-Term Persistence of Three Microbial Wildfire Biomarkers in Forest Soils

Abstract: Long-term monitoring of microbial communities in the rhizosphere of post-fire forests is currently one of the key knowledge gaps. Knowing the time scale of the effects is indispensable to aiding post-fire recovery in vulnerable woodlands, including holm oak forests, that are subjected to a Mediterranean climate, as is the case with forests that are found in protected areas such as the Sierra Nevada National and Natural Park in southeastern Spain.
